What is Organoleptic Evaluation of Foods?

Organoleptic evaluation involves assessing the sensory properties of foods, including their taste, smell, texture, and appearance. This process helps identify any defects or anomalies in the product that may affect its quality, safety, or consumer acceptance. By evaluating these key attributes, food manufacturers can:

  • Identify potential problems early on

  • Improve product formulation and processing

  • Enhance customer satisfaction and loyalty
